#60cba4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60cba4 is composed of 37.6% red, 79.6%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.2%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 158.1 degrees, a saturation of 50.7% and a lightness of 58.6%. #60cba4 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ffff with #009749.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#60cba4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60cba4 has RGB values of R:96, G:203,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.19,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 6343588.

Shades and Tints of #60cba4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010403 is the darkest color, while #f4fb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#60cba4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919a97 is the less saturated color, while #2ffcb1 is the most saturated one.
